Carpet, Upholstery, Mattress

Cleaning In The Nation

Our Services

Explore Our Residential Services and Commercial Packages.

Based in Casselman, ON - We offer our services in all regions in between Ottawa, Hawkesbury and Cornwall.

Nation Cleaning Commercial Cleaning

EXPLORE COMMERCIAL CLEANING

Bring your business back to life with clean carpets and great packages.

A Special Offer

For You

Until September 1st, Enjoy A

10% Discount on ALL UPHOLSTERY

(That means any type of

couch, love seat and chair)

Click to Contact Us or Book Online!

-
Days
-
Hours
-
Minutes
-
Seconds
Contact Us
Before cleaning a couch with Nation Cleaning
before cleaning a couch with nation cleaning

NEW SERVICE FOR AREA RUGS

We now have a new way to

clean your area rugs!

Click below to check out

our new process or to

book your area rug cleaning.

SEE OUR PROCESS
Clean carpets benefits
Before and after working with Nation Cleaning

A history of caring

Locally owned & family-operated for over 8 years. Jean Lamadeleine is a school principal for the CSDCEO. He built Nation Cleaning with a passion for helping families enjoy clean, healthy homes.

We believe in honest work, fair pricing, and delivering results you can see.

Owner Of Nation Cleaning
Get in touch with Nation Cleaning